About

Zhaoming Deng is a scholar working on Molecular Biology, Oral Surgery and Physiology. According to data from OpenAlex, Zhaoming Deng has authored 12 papers receiving a total of 220 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Molecular Biology, 4 papers in Oral Surgery and 3 papers in Physiology. Recurrent topics in Zhaoming Deng's work include RNA modifications and cancer (3 papers), Bone Tissue Engineering Materials (3 papers) and Dental Implant Techniques and Outcomes (2 papers). Zhaoming Deng is often cited by papers focused on RNA modifications and cancer (3 papers), Bone Tissue Engineering Materials (3 papers) and Dental Implant Techniques and Outcomes (2 papers). Zhaoming Deng collaborates with scholars based in China, United States and Macao. Zhaoming Deng's co-authors include Amir I. Mina, Alexander S. Banks, Jun Liang, Xiangwei Li, Jonathan Z. Long, Mark P. Jedrychowski, Shangyu Hong, Steven P. Gygi, Jessica A. Hall and Peter‐James H. Zushin and has published in prestigious journals such as Proceedings of the National Academy of Sciences, International Journal of Biological Macromolecules and Dental Materials.
